Indoor Play + Seating
- Urban Air Lenexa & Overland Park – Adventure parks with Wi-Fi, tables (and even couches!) and weekday energy that helps kids burn off steam.
- Kids Empire – Large indoor playgrounds with plenty of parent viewing space make this a go-to for quick work sessions.
- My Play Café Northland KC – Supervised Play + Co-Working (Wednesdays 4–7 p.m.) – A midweek option where parents can work while kids play in a staff-supervised, enclosed area. No drop-offs; food and drinks available, and space is limited.
- Inspired Play Café – A Montessori-inspired play café with imaginative play areas, Wi-Fi and a full café menu, offering a calm space for parents to work or recharge during open play sessions.

Coffee Shops & Community Spaces
- Foundry Coffeehouse – A relaxed environment for working parents, with a welcoming, family-friendly feel.
- McLain’s Bakery & Market – Grab a coffee while the kids stay happy with a pastry. The McLain’s Market in Shawnee (5833 Nieman Rd) is especially great on nice days, featuring a family-friendly outdoor patio with turf, kid-sized tables and yard games in a casual, enclosed setting.



- Kaw Prairie Church – Community gatherings, playtimes and flexible spaces that often attract work-from-home parents.
- Rainbow of the Heartland – A supportive community space where families often gather for connection and kid-friendly activities.
Libraries That Work for Everyone
- Johnson County Library Branches – Many locations offer play areas, early literacy zones and comfortable seating for working parents.
- Central Resource Library – A favorite for its spacious layout, natural light and kid-friendly programming.
- Olathe Library Branches – Quiet corners for focus plus children’s areas that keep little ones engaged.
Parks Perfect for Laptop Time
- Lenexa Parks – Playgrounds and shaded seating make it easy to answer emails outdoors while kids explore.
- Thompson Park (Downtown Overland Park) – A walkable green space near coffee shops and local businesses, ideal for short work breaks.
- Green Street (Downtown Lee’s Summit) – A lively outdoor gathering space with turf, seating areas and room for kids to move while parents catch up on work or enjoy a nearby coffee stop.
